Kani Khet Village Population, Sex Ratio & Literacy Rate
Kani Khet is a village in Gangolihat tehsil, Pithoragarh district, Uttarakhand, India. As per Census 2011, the total population is 10, sex ratio is 150 females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 90.00%. The PIN code of Kani Khet is 262500.
